Throwback Thursday – When the Floor Gave Out

Back in 2020, we discovered what “going through the floor” really meant. 😳 Parts of the Little House had to be completely rebuilt—floor, joists, and even some foundation blocks. Thanks to dedicated volunteers, we got it patched up enough to keep the doors open.

But the rest of the flooring in the Little House remains one of our most critical repair needs today. 💚

Our recent fundraiser got us a little closer, but we are still far from our overall goal. We continue to seek donations so we can finish these urgent repairs and ensure the Little House stands strong for the next 75 years of Girl Scouts.

THROWBACK THURSDAY - Covid Didn't Stop Us
Even during Covid, Girl Scouting at the Little House continued—just with a creative twist! 🎃✨

This Tent n Treat event was held mostly outside, with tents decorated by older Girl Scouts for trick-or-treating and songs around the fire. Inside, crafts were made safely with tables wiped down after each small group.

The Little House has always been a place where Girl Scouts can adapt, gather, and make memories—no matter the circumstances. 💚

THROWBACK THURSDAY - Community Service

Donations for the Salvation Army almost filled our Little House in March of 1976. Danwood Girl Scouts, including these Brownies in troop 630, distributed 2,500 bags throughout Hendricks county to collect donations. Community service projects continue to be a big part of Girl Scouts.

THROWBACK THURSDAY – Badge Day at the Little House

Senior Troop 950, led by Sharon Seward, sponsored a Badge Day at the Danville Little House, to help Junior and Cadette Girl Scouts earn their badges. The badges included: Sports Sampler, Water Wonders, Architecture, Books, First Aid and Out-of-Doors Dabbler.

Senior Troop members who led the activities were: Sandy Seward, president of Troop 950, Karen Pride, Chris Fulmer, Meshelle Hayes, Cindy Seward, Marianne Herrmann and Della Burkhart... Gloria Higgins and Edith Spangler gave a helping hand in teaching first aid skills.

This week's Throwback Thursday comes from Nancy Wills who shared this picture of her Girl Scout troop in 1968 along with the following memories:

"Our Girl Scout Troop began at an early age with various girls from the 1960’s involved. Our earlier leaders were Betty Headrick and Lorena Rutledge. We met at the Girl Scout Little House, sold cookies, earned badges just as they do today. We went to Delwood Sherwood Forest Camp and to Camp Gallahue in Brown County, usually staying at the USS Ardath. The troop continued throughout our high school years, ending in a trip in June 1968 to Gatlinburg, Tennessee and walking part of the Appalachian Trial, spending one night on the trail. Each camping experience was an adventure. We hope future Girl Scouts will continue to enjoy all the experiences gained by being a part of Girl Scouts."

Pictured with maiden and married names if known:
FRONT ROW: Nancy Rutledge Wills, Mary Griffin Thomas, Lucia Granath O'Brien, Pat Cox, Nancy Wills Martin
BACK ROW: Ann Guthrie Tussey, Karen Gossett, Rosalyn Terrill Ladd, Miriam Orelup Geib, Lorena Rutledge, Jean Anne Funk, Alice Cox and in the center, Anne Roulet.
Not pictured, but part of the troop, Sharon Robinson Cramer.
